The Pedernales-Cabo Rojo Project Explained

This ambitious plan includes:

  • 12,000 hotel rooms built over the next 10 years.

  • Phase one: 4,700 rooms led by Iberostar and Inclusive Collection (Hyatt).

  • Supporting infrastructure such as restaurants, shops, and cultural attractions.

What to Do in Pedernales, Dominican Republic

Even before the resorts are complete, Pedernales offers plenty to explore:

Activity

Why It’s Special

Bahía de las Águilas

A secluded, crystal-clear beach often ranked among the most beautiful in the Caribbean.

Jaragua National Park

A UNESCO Biosphere Reserve with flamingos, lagoons, and unique wildlife.

Hoyo de Pelempito

A stunning sinkhole with breathtaking views from its lookout points.

Eco-tours

Perfect for travelers interested in sustainable and adventure tourism.

How to Get to Pedernales

  • From Santo Domingo: About 6 hours by car (private transfers or rental cars recommended).

  • From Punta Cana: Around 8 hours by road.

  • Airport plans: A new international airport is in discussion as part of the project.
